Andrabi reviews development scenario in Dooru constituency

ANANTNAG, MARCH 20: Member of Legislative Assembly Dooru, Syed Farooq Ahmad Andrabi today chaired a review meeting at Verinag Rest House to take stock of pace of the developmental works in his constituency.

The DDC Anantnag, Mohammad Younis Malik gave a PowerPoint presentation highlighting the achievements registered so far and the pace of execution of various ongoing works.

R&B department is executing 44 works out of which 17 have been completed so far. An expenditure of Rs 5228 lakh has been spent so far against the approved cost of Rs 15128 lakh.  The concerned Exen R&B informed that 59.6 kms of road length have been macadamised this year.

The MLA was informed that the approved labour budget under MGNREGS for 2017-18 for the 4 blocks of the AC is Rs 704.91 lacs for which the generation of 236285 persondays was targeted. However, the department has exceeded the target by generating 379087 persondays completing 956 works.

Under NRDWP, the PHE Division Qazigund is executing 26 schemes at an estimated cost of Rs 4429 lakh which shall be benefitting 115197 souls. Besides, other 90 schemes under Minor Irrigation Schemes are going on at an estimated cost of Rs 2789.84 lakh.

The PDD is executing 4 works regarding augmentation of receiving stations at Shankerpora, Dooru, Dialgam and Dooru feeder segregation. Similarly, under PMGSY, 205 works have been allotted since 2015 out of which 136 have been completed so far.

In Horticulture sector, an amount of Rs 26.37 lakh has been extended as a subsidy under MIDH and PMDP for pack houses, vermicompost, etc.

The MLA also reviewed the pace of work in Model Cluster Village, Bakerwal Chek. The concerned officers apprised the chair about the status of different works.

Meanwhile, the MLA directed all the concerned officers to get the pending works completed at an earliest so that people can enjoy the fruits of development. He called for coordination between different departments so that holistic development is ensured.

The MLA called for harmonization of the teaching staff according to the student ratio so that quality education is ensured.
